What you will be responsible for?

As a Graduate Estimator, you'll be working within the Construction team and will play a pivotal role in preparing accurate and competitive cost estimates for construction projects including materials, transport, labour, and equipment. This role is designed for a recent graduate eager to launch a career in construction management

 

What will your day-to-day duties include?

  • Assisting in the preparation of detailed and accurate cost estimates for construction projects.
  • Analysing project plans, specifications, and other documentation to prepare time, cost, materials, and labour estimates.
  • Collaborating with architects, engineers, and contractors to gather essential information for estimates.
  • Supporting the development of project budgets and cost control measures.
  • Assisting in preparing bid proposals and tender documents.
  • Conducting site visits to understand project scope and gather relevant data.
